
Has the cargo market recovery started? Cathay and EVA Air yields start to improve
19th October, 2009
Cathay Pacific has noted that the trend of "plummeting cargo yields" that began in 4Q2008 and continued through 2Q2009 has stopped, as volumes have strengthened. [1151 words]
